And so what we're going to do is announce the top three winners, but I did want to do criteria one more time, just so everyone knows that when we're making these remarks, we're taking it very seriously. We're thinking about it and we're trying to be honest, technical, and also of course, friendly too. But just like the criteria that go into the challenge itself, degree of innovation, the market relevance, and also how you're going to market. You hear that we make a lot of remarks about how you're going market, how you fit into the tech stack, what are the competitive advantages, and then overall demo quality and salesmanship. Alright, we're going to do the top three. So when we announce, I'm going to start with the third place winner. And we hope that everybody's here. So have you come up. We'll do a fun little photo op and we'll do three and then two. And then we will announce the winner of course. Last. So in third place is drum roll, please. Yes, we got blend in third place with their AI powered lo copilot. All right. There we go. Come on up. All nice job. Congrats. So congratulations. Yeah. Alright. Get in here for Get in here, Heidi. Awesome. Congratulations. Blend. All right. It's both. Yes. Okay. Second place is Haven with their blend of bringing in the originations and the servicing together all in one. So bring it up Haven. Congratulations. A newer entrant into the market. Always loved seeing the earlier stage companies winning too. Thank you much. Congrats. Thank you. Congratulations.
